Health care includes taking care of your teeth. That’s more than just cosmetic. Dental care is important for your overall health. Before 2024, most Canadians paid for dental care out of pocket or relied on private insurance. (Provinces provided free or subsidized dental care for some populations, like children and older adults.) But with the introduction of the Canadian Dental Care Plan, things are changing.
Why was dental care left out of Canada’s Medicare system?
Canada’s universal health care system (also known as Medicare) pays for Canadians to have access to physician services — this includes hospital visits, diagnostics (meaning the tests and professionals who interpret them) and visits with doctors in primary care settings or specialists. When Medicare was introduced, dental care was not included.
